A post-doctoral position funded by the Leverhulme Trust is available in the laboratory of Leon Lagnado to study the flow of information controlling visually-driven behaviour. Fluorescent reporters of neural activity will be used in conjunction with advanced imaging methods and behavioural assays to investigate how the signals transmitted through different visual pathways in larval zebrafish determine behavioural outputs such as the optomotor response, prey capture and the optokinetic response. We are particularly interested in how factors that modulate the operation of visual circuits impact these behaviours.

We are a very active research group ) embedded in a strong research culture in which a number of other groups use imaging and electrophysiology to study neural circuits involved in sensory processing ).

We are located in the vibrant city of Brighton and London is 1 hour away.

Applicants must have a Ph.D in Neuroscience (this could be experimental or computational).
